About the role
- Play an integral role on our Engineering Team by identifying root cause and implementing corrective action activities.
- Support continuous improvement initiatives and present findings and results to customers and senior management.
- Implement and sustain elements of the QMS (Quality Management System), including corrective actions, supplier quality management, and customer complaints.
- Deploy Process Controls throughout the operating system, teaming with operations to improve COPQ performance and conduct training to achieve goals.
- Conduct formal root-cause analysis and corrective actions to eliminate defective products.
- Help develop process controls to reduce process variation to target control limits.
- Routinely update SOP’s, operator work instructions, and training materials to reflect continuous improvement to quality.
- Monitor, control, and analyze product and process quality to meet customer requirements.
- Participate in continuous improvement initiatives and partner with production in detecting root causes for defects during production phases.
- Work with Quality Manager in analyzing data for developing and implementing preventative measures to reduce quality defects.
- Facilitate Lean Six Sigma process improvement opportunities and assure compliance with policies.
Requirements
- Associate’s degree required; Bachelor’s degree in a technical field preferred.
- Minimum of 3 years of experience working in a quality production environment.
- Lean/Six Sigma Green certification preferred.
- ASQ CQE Certification a plus.
- ISO 9001:2015 Internal or other quality management systems preferred.
- Subject matter expert (SME) on Quality systems; gage and inspection systems with defined CARS and remediation to drive performance improvements.
- Implementation, supporting and or improving Quality Management System (QMS) preferred.
- Understand and developed systems to support ISO 9001.
- Demonstrated ability to lead, coach, and develop effective teams without extensive oversight.
- Possess excellent collaborative, analytical, problem-solving and communication skills.
- Proficient using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, etc.).
- Ability to multi-task and handle tasks or projects with competing priorities.
